Ceya Northbrooke Thorne Glade is a human living in a cottage in Lakeshire in Redridge Mountains. The cottage is beside the forge.

Ceya was born in Goldshire, raised in an Eastvale logging camp, and then she moved with her mother to the coast. She met her husband, Greydon Thorne in Stormwind Harbor and they moved to Lakeshire together. There she gave birth to Aram. On his sixth birthday, Greydon mysteriously abandoned his family, leaving Ceya in grief. She waited for him for two years and then became close with town's blacksmith, Robb Glade. She asked Magistrate Solomon to declare Greydon dead, so she could marry Robb. With him she has two children, Robertson and Selya. Six years after the abandonment, Greydon returned and asked for Aram to come sailing with him for one year. Ceya agreed, stating that Aram needs to know the world.[2]

She knitted and gifted a grey woolen cable sweater to Aram on his eleventh birthday.[3]

Later, Makasa Flintwill arrived to tell her about the whereabouts of her son.[4]
